Output 19d8d109357714ce4fb2e7edea8064bc7cfebbdf2b318ecb25791fc4c0b830c8:0

value
311285943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c1079443d2c2e9630454a01fdaa52f34497b273 OP_EQUAL
address
3BYQdseQzRWXiPy3NZLhpjLDNL8RPSLdu6
transaction
19d8d109357714ce4fb2e7edea8064bc7cfebbdf2b318ecb25791fc4c0b830c8
confirmations
319305
spent
true